NUR 6500 - Leadership and Management Practicum I

1 lecture hours 12 lab hours 5 credits
Course Description
This course focuses on the synthesis of concepts in the practice environment including the design, management, and evaluation of comprehensive person-centered care. Students participate in a practicum experience where they apply models of quality improvement, informatics, leadership, organizational behavior, human resource management, change, and financial management in a selected health care setting. (prereq: NUR 6140 )
Course Learning Outcomes
Upon successful completion of this course, the student will be able to:
  • Synthesize theoretical knowledge into activities in the practice setting
  • Designs, delivers, manages, and evaluates comprehensive person-centered care
  • Participate in leadership and management activities at the designed agency
  • Formulate a personal development plan related to professional competencies
  • Approach practice and projects with a spirit of curiosity and inquiry and an awareness of best practices
